Output 21d22808a154b3072afe990ac7863ef1d597705e64563d3699d0ae75ccafd2a9:1

value
250800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95bc4c76d02a08ef7320eade54b50a6b864a2d2a OP_EQUAL
address
3FLkBMBF52Quw6PxKmpYHFc7EBzDB9PTg2
transaction
21d22808a154b3072afe990ac7863ef1d597705e64563d3699d0ae75ccafd2a9
confirmations
488913
spent
true